How to use lionized in a sentence

The brusque and rather timid young officer is lionized in the drawing-room of Madame Tallien.
NAPOLEON'S YOUNG NEIGHBORHELEN LEAH REED
In her own circle of friends and acquaintances she was lionized.
MARY WOLLSTONECRAFTELIZABETH ROBINS PENNELL
There and in London he was "lionized," as Franklin had been in Paris.
THE LIFE OF THOMAS PAINE, VOL. I. (OF II)MONCURE DANIEL CONWAY
Many an ass has been lionized before, and many a one will be so again.
CATHOLIC WORLD, VOL. XIII, APRIL TO SEPTEMBER, 1871VARIOUS
Of course he was honored, idolized and lionized by the colored people wherever he was known.
THE FACTS OF RECONSTRUCTIONJOHN R. LYNCH
She gained in reputation, was received with great attention in society, and lionized more than she cared for.
LOUISA MAY ALCOTTLOUISA MAY ALCOTT
"It is rather pleasant to be lionized, but we shall be obliged to draw the lines somewhere," said Dr. Jones.
DOCTOR JONES' PICNICS. E. CHAPMAN
The superfluous man's beloved is at last seduced by the lionized prince, and she becomes the talk of the town.
LECTURES ON RUSSIAN LITERATUREIVAN PANIN
Lionized to death, as the English alone can lionize, Mr. Prescott never lost his modest self-possession.
THE ART OF ENTERTAININGM. E. W. SHERWOOD
Where'er he goes the brawny Goth is lionized by all, like Caesar, when he cut a swath along the Lupercal.
RIPPLING RHYMESWALT MASON
